Sunday (April 20/Easter Sunday) Pastoral Prayer


April 20, 2025 (Easter Sunday)
Beulah UMC & Oak Grove UMC

Risen Christ, this day just never gets old, even for those of us who have been attending Easter worship services all our lives. We continue to be amazed that on that first Easter, you pulled off what no one has ever been able to do, to be the first person to be resurrected from the dead.

 

Sure, we have heard stories of people coming back to life after having been pronounced dead, but this was different. You not only came back from the dead, but you were also resurrected with a new body, one that would never ever see death again. Even though we can’t fully explain how you were able to do this, you invite us to believe anyway and like Mary, all you ask is that we go and tell others about this good news.

 

But why should we wait until after the service? We will offer this good news now in this time of prayer as we lift up to you people on our hearts and minds who are in need of your healing, guiding, and comforting presence. We pray for those on our prayer list as well as others who we lift up to you silently. [PAUSE]

 

And yes, we also pray for ourselves to not allow our doubts and fears to rob us of the surprising good news that your tomb is empty. And just as it may be extremely difficult to explain how this can be, remind us that it is equally difficult to explain it away as if it really didn’t happen. Help us to stand in awe and amazement of the holy mystery that this day of Easter represents.

 

As your Easter people, we join now in praying these words that you taught us to say together knowing that you can do far more than we can ever think, ask or imagine…

=

Our Father, who art in heaven, hallowed be thy name. Thy kingdom come. Thy will be done on earth as it is in heaven. Give us this day our daily bread and forgive us our trespasses as we forgive those who trespass against us. And lead us not into temptation but deliver us from evil. For thine is the kingdom and the power and the glory forever. Amen.
